#34589f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34589f is composed of 20.4% red, 34.5%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#34589f color hex could be obtained by blending #68b0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#34589f color description : Dark moderate blue.

#34589f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#34589f has RGB values of R:52, G:88,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3430559.

Shades and Tints of #34589f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#34589f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65686e is the less saturated color, while #0348d0 is the most saturated one.
